ToggleWhat Is Pay Per Head Sportsbook?

A Pay Per Head (PPH) sportsbook is like your personal betting assistant, optimizing the sports betting experience for enthusiasts and bookies alike. Instead of navigating the complicated world of odds and transactions alone, PPH services provide a platform where you can place and manage bets seamlessly. Essentially, clients pay a fee per head (hence the name) for every person who uses the service. This system includes all the necessary tools to run a successful sportsbook, from odds compilation to player management.
In a nutshell, it’s turning the traditional betting model on its head, giving users more flexibility and control than ever before. Key Features of Pay Per Head Services
Pay Per Head services come loaded with features designed to make betting smoother and more efficient. Here are some of the crucial offerings that set these providers apart:
1. Comprehensive Betting Options
Gone are the days of limited betting lines. With a quality PPH service, users can access a wide range of sports, including football, basketball, baseball, and more exotic options like esports or MMA. If you can bet on it, a PPH platform will likely have it.
2. User-Friendly Interface
Most reputable PPH providers offer sleek, navigable interfaces. That way, bettors can easily find what they’re looking for without feeling like they’re deciphering hieroglyphics.
3. Real-Time Data and Analytics
Users benefit from live odds updates and statistics, keeping them informed and ready to make strategic decisions. Being able to react quickly to changing odds? That’s what it’s all about.
4. Risk Management Tools
For those running their own sportsbooks, PPH services help manage risk effectively. With tools to monitor betting patterns and set limits, these services provide peace of mind.
5. 24/7 Customer Support
Let’s face it, questions will arise at the most inconvenient times. Reliable PPH services have round-the-clock support to address any issues promptly.
Benefits of Using a Pay Per Head Sportsbook
Using a PPH sportsbook comes with benefits that can enhance the betting experience significantly. Here are some compelling reasons to consider this approach:
1. Cost-Effective
Instead of incurring hefty operational costs typical of traditional sportsbooks, PPH services allow users to pay based on usage. This model is budget-friendly, especially for beginners still learning the ropes of sports betting.
2. Enhanced Flexibility
Users can place bets anytime, anywhere, as long as they have internet access. This flexibility suits today’s fast-paced lifestyle, letting bettors stay engaged even on the go.
3. Improved Betting Experience
With features designed for convenience, like easy access to various betting options and real-time updates, bettors enjoy a smoother overall experience. Who doesn’t appreciate hassle-free betting?
4. Comprehensive Management
For those who operate their own sportsbooks, PPH services offer management tools that simplify everything from accounting to player tracking. You can spend less time on tedious tasks and more on developing your business and enjoying your betting experience.
Latest Trends in Sports Betting
The sports betting landscape is ever-evolving. Staying in touch with the latest trends can provide insights into where the industry is headed. Here are some recent developments:
1. Mobile Betting Surge
The convenience of mobile betting is hard to ignore. More bettors are placing wagers directly from their phones, making it imperative for PPH services to optimize their platforms for mobile users.
2. Integration of Technology
With advancements in data analytics and artificial intelligence, sportsbooks are utilizing these technologies to offer personalized experiences. From tailored odds to customized promotions, technology is shaping every aspect of sports betting.
3. Growing Popularity of Esports
Esports is booming, and sportsbooks are taking notice. Integrating esports into regular sportsbook platforms caters to a younger audience eager to engage in betting on games they already follow.
4. Regulation Changes
As more states continue to legalize sports betting, understanding the changing regulations is vital. Keeping up with legal changes ensures that bettors know their rights and responsibilities.
Choosing the Right Pay Per Head Provider
Selecting a provider can feel like finding a needle in a haystack: but, keeping a few crucial factors in mind can make the process smoother:
1. Reputation and Reliability
Ensure the provider has a solid reputation in the industry. Research customer reviews and testimonials to gauge their reliability. You want tech that won’t ditch you during a big game.
2. Range of Features
Different providers offer different features, so look for one that offers the services that meet your specific needs, whether you want extensive stats or simple interfaces.
3. Competitive Pricing
While cost shouldn’t be the only factor, it’s essential to compare pricing across different providers to ensure you’re getting good value for your money.
4. Customer Support
A responsive support team can make all the difference. Choose a provider with a solid support mechanism you can rely on, especially during critical betting events.
